66 The Invasion
That evening, Gavadiol stood behind the window blinds and stared out at the city, his city, with the lights twinkling like stars. Would this city be fully his by this time tomorrow?
Or would he be lying in the pool of his own blood, dead or terribly injured?
But funny enough, even as he contemplated these things, a familiar feeling began to rise from deep within him. It was the feeling of excitement. The excitement of a good scrap that lay ahead.
He turned to Konstantin and found the lad lying on his back, his eyes wide open.
“Konstantin, how do you feel?” He asked. “Are you afraid?”
“To be honest yeah,” the big fellow responded frankly. “But I am always going to be with you no matter where you go so I don't count it as anything.”
Gavadiol reflected gratefully on that for a moment. “But Konstantin, you know you don't have to do that. This is my fight. You don't have to get involved.”
